Selecting the Right End Cutting Tool for Your Task

Selecting the appropriate end mill is critical for getting excellent results in any metalworking project. Evaluate the material you’ll be cutting – hardened steel requires a get more info unique end mill than softer plastic. The tool's geometry, including the number of edges and pitch angle, greatly impacts its performance. In addition, consider the cut depth and feed rate you plan to use; a larger DOC often requires a stronger end mill.

Grooving Tools vs. End Mills: What's the Difference?

Choosing the correct cutter for a specific operation can be tricky , especially when evaluating grooving tools and end mills. While both remove material, they work with fundamentally different constructions and are intended for contrasting applications. End mills, with their numerous cutting edges , are typically used for broad milling, slotting, and profiling – effectively, creating complex shapes. They can execute slight grooves, but aren’t optimized for deep ones. Grooving tools, conversely, are focused instruments specifically designed for cutting narrow and profound grooves. They feature a solitary cutting rim – often configured for maximum workpiece displacement in a limited space .

Optimal Practices for Employing 1 End Mill Tools

To achieve optimal efficiency and extend the longevity of your 1 profile mill cutters , adhere to several crucial practices. Firstly , ensure correct securing and balance – vibration can severely degrade the machining edge. Furthermore , choose the correct rate and depth cut based on the workpiece being processed . Consistently examine the bit for wear and replace it when necessary; worn cutters can lead to inadequate surface quality and increased risk of damage. Finally, use appropriate lubrication to lessen heat and improve bit duration.
